Analysis
In 2024, veneer sheets — export quantity in China, Hong Kong SAR stood at 176 m3.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 29.0% on the previous year and down 92.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, veneer sheets — export quantity in China, Hong Kong SAR peaked at 179,970 m3 in 2002 and was at its lowest, 100 m3, in 1982.
That places China, Hong Kong SAR 96th out of 231 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 620 m3 | 300 m3 | 1,100 m3 | 5 |
| 1980s | 2,840 m3 | 100 m3 | 10,700 m3 | 10 |
| 1990s | 25,792 m3 | 191 m3 | 90,000 m3 | 10 |
| 2000s | 20,044 m3 | 168 m3 | 179,970 m3 | 10 |
| 2010s | 1,153 m3 | 422 m3 | 2,451 m3 | 10 |
| 2020s | 243 m3 | 176 m3 | 300 m3 | 5 |

About this data
The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
